Lily is making smoothies. each smoothie uses 1/2 cup of yogurt. How many cups of yogurt does she need to make 3 smoothies? Express your answer in simplest form

To find out how many cups of yogurt Lily needs to make 3 smoothies, we need to multiply the amount of yogurt used in one smoothie by the number of smoothies:

Amount of yogurt in one smoothie: 1/2 cup
Number of smoothies: 3

To multiply fractions, we simply multiply the numerators together and the denominators together:

(1/2) * 3/1

Multiplying the numerators, we get 1 * 3 = 3. Multiplying the denominators, we get 2 * 1 = 2.

So, 1/2 * 3/1 = 3/2.

Therefore, Lily needs 3/2 cups of yogurt to make 3 smoothies.
